While direct support options aren't explicitly detailed beyond "First Release Technical Support" and "responsive team," testimonials highlight the helpfulness of the team and an active Discord community.Technical DetailsShipThing is built on a modern, fully-typed codebase using Next.js and TypeScript. It leverages Clerk for authentication, Prisma and Neon for database management, and Hono for a type-safe API. UI development is accelerated with Shadcn/ui components, and deployment is flexible, supporting serverless Vercel, Node.js, and Docker environments.
